Definitions:

Combining Vowel

A vowel, often 'o', used in medical terms to ease the pronunciation between word roots and suffixes or between multiple roots.

Dentalgia

Pain located in a tooth or teeth, commonly known as toothache.

Laparoscopy

A minimally invasive surgical procedure that uses a thin, lighted tube passed through a small incision to examine or treat conditions within the abdomen or pelvis.

Lapar/o

A prefix used in medical terminology to refer to the abdomen or abdominal wall.
